1. Encourage Healthy Eating Habits

Healthy eating habits are essential for a healthy body. It is important to urge your family to consume a well-balanced diet with ample f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, whole grains, and healthy fats. Reducing the consumption of processed foods, sugary beverages, and snacks is recommended. Plan and prepare meals that are nutritious and enjoyable for the whole family. Involve your children in meal planning and grocery shopping to encourage healthy choices.

Ensure you have healthy options in your home to encourage healthy eating habits. Keep fresh fruits, vegetables, seeds, and nuts in the house as snacks. Avoid buying junk food or sugary drinks. Instead, choose healthier alternatives such as water, unsweetened tea, or natural fruit juices.

2. Make Physical Activity a Priority

Physical activity is essential for a healthy body. Encourage your family members to be physically active by engaging in activities such as walking, running, swimming, cycling, or playing sports. Aim for at least 30 minutes of physical activity every day. Find activities that the whole family can enjoy together, such as going for a walk after dinner or playing a game of soccer in the backyard.

To prioritize physical activity, create a schedule for physical activity that everyone can follow. Encourage your children to participate in sports or other physical activities outside school. Ensure everyone has access to appropriate footwear and clothing for physical activity.

3. Manage Stress

Stress can hurt your family’s overall health. It’s important to manage stress levels and create a healthy environment at home.

Here are some ways you can help your family manage stress:

Create a Stress-Free Environment

Creating a stress-free environment in your home is an important step in helping your family manage their stress levels. Ensure your home’s interior is clean and organized, as clutter can cause further stress. Ensure that everyone has appropriate personal space where they can go to relax. Implement consistent bedtimes and healthy meals to promote a healthy lifestyle.

Encourage Open Communication

Open communication is key to reducing stress within the family unit. Make sure to listen attentively when your family members share their concerns with you and that everyone is heard without judgment or criticism. Ensure that each family member knows their opinion matters, which will validate their feelings and help them to manage their stress better.

Practice Relaxation Techniques

To manage stress effectively, your family members need to be able to identify signs of stress and know how to relax in such situations. Teach them relaxation techniques such as meditation, deep breathing, yoga, or mindfulness activities; these can help reduce tension and stress.

Incorporate Fun Activities

Incorporate fun activities into your family’s daily routine to help reduce stress levels. This can be anything from board games to movie nights, outdoor picnics, or cooking together. Doing something as a family will provide an opportunity for bonding and spending quality time with each other, which can help bring down any tension that may have built up due to stress.

4. Get Enough Sleep

Getting enough sleep is essential for overall health. Encourage your family members to establish a regular sleep schedule and stick to it. Ensure everyone has a comfortable and supportive sleeping environment, such as a comfortable mattress and pillow. Encourage your children to establish good sleep habits by avoiding caffeine and electronic devices before bed.

To get enough sleep, create a sleep-friendly environment in your home. Make sure that the bedroom is dark, quiet, and at a comfortable temperature. Encourage your family to wind down before bed by reading a book or taking a warm bath.

5. Regularly Visit the Doctor and Dentist

Visiting the doctor and dentist regularly is essential to maintaining your family’s overall health. Regular checkups with a reliable dentist will help diagnose potential dental problems early and provide reliable treatment. Your dentist will also help educate your family on proper oral hygiene and nutrition to maintain healthy teeth and gums.

It is also important to visit the doctor regularly for preventive care, such as immunizations and screenings. Regular checkups with your doctor can help detect potential health issues early, which can be essential in preventing long-term health complications. Make sure to find a reliable dentist and doctor for your family members so they can get the best care possible.
